Charity drum-a-thon wraps up
The Big Beat crashed to its conclusion at the Villa Marina yesterday afternoon.
Six percussionists slogged through a consecutive fifty-three hours and eight minutes of drumming to music, in aid of Craig's Heartstrong Foundation.
Last time the event took place in 2014, thousands were raised - but organisers are predicting the target will be smashed this time around.
